No. The size of an icon does not have to be equal size with a Jesus icon. Most of the time you'll see two of Jesus and Mary together because of their hearts; Jesus with the Sacred Heart and Mary with the Immaculate Heart. I also wouldn't used the term altar for a prayer corner/table as an altar is consecrated and used to celebrate Mass.
